Leroy Jackson Potter was born in 1851 in Smithville, De Kalb, Tennessee, USA, the child of David H Potter And Elizabeth Magness. In 1870, Leroy Jackson Potter resided in District 5, Dekalb, Tennessee. In 1880, Leroy Jackson Potter resided in District 15, Warren, Tennessee, United States. Leroy Jackson Potter married Mary Eliza Whaley, and had children including Bailey Brown Potter, Benton Hooper Potter, David Hamilton Potter, Edward Pritz Potter, Frank Bell Potter, Henri Ola Potter, Samuel Harrison Potter. Leroy Jackson Potter passed away in 1919 in Hamilton, Tennessee, USA.
